  PCW Magazine 28/07 1983
Issue number 30 of volume 2. Includes a feature on the Sinclair ZX Spectrum peripherals.

In Excellent condition. 9/10.

Popular Computing Weekly, or PCW magazine, was a weekly publication covering the hardware and software launches of the day, and was also famed for its hilarious Pi-Man comic strip throughout the mid-1980s.

These days PCW provides vital chronological documentation of the story of computing and gaming in the UK as it unfolded.
